Why does screen printing still matter for Cincinnati businesses today? Screen printing still matters because it delivers durability, consistency, and cost efficiency for branded apparel that local businesses rely on every day. From restaurant uniforms in Over-the-Rhine to construction crews in Blue Ash and nonprofit event shirts downtown, screen printing remains the most trusted method for producing apparel that gets worn, washed, and reused repeatedly.
